You will get custom scripts to automate your Indesign, Illustrator or Photoshop
Top Rated

Project details
I'll build custom document automation across your Adobe stack — InDesign, Illustrator, or Photoshop — engineered to be safe, repeatable, and run unattended.
The engineering you'll get:
• ExtendScript inside the Adobe app + Node orchestration outside, so the whole pipeline runs end-to-end
• Tolerant data parsing — bad rows are quarantined, not crashed on
• Idempotent runs and per-record logs — safe to re-run after a fix
• Output naming conventions and manifests so the result is auditable
Best fit when:
• A human currently does this manually for hours per run
• You ship the same artifact with different data every week (catalogs, contracts, certificates, marked-up reports, batched exports)
• You need print-ready PDF + the editable source from the same pass
I'll set up the template binding, the data validation, and the run script — and leave you with something your team can run on demand.
Listed alongside backend work because the engineering — orchestration, error handling, scale — is the same craft.
The engineering you'll get:
• ExtendScript inside the Adobe app + Node orchestration outside, so the whole pipeline runs end-to-end
• Tolerant data parsing — bad rows are quarantined, not crashed on
• Idempotent runs and per-record logs — safe to re-run after a fix
• Output naming conventions and manifests so the result is auditable
Best fit when:
• A human currently does this manually for hours per run
• You ship the same artifact with different data every week (catalogs, contracts, certificates, marked-up reports, batched exports)
• You need print-ready PDF + the editable source from the same pass
I'll set up the template binding, the data validation, and the run script — and leave you with something your team can run on demand.
Listed alongside backend work because the engineering — orchestration, error handling, scale — is the same craft.
Programming Languages
JavaScriptOperating System
WindowsDesktop App Expertise
Application Review & OptimizationApplication
Microsoft ExcelWhat's included
| Service Tiers |
Starter
$100
|
Standard
$150
|
Advanced
$300
|
|---|---|---|---|
| Delivery Time | 1 day | 4 days | 7 days |
Number of Revisions | Unlimited | Unlimited | Unlimited |
Source Code |
Optional add-ons
You can add these on the next page.
Fast Delivery
+$50 - $100
81 reviews
(77)
(4)
(0)
(0)
(0)
RS
Rory S.
Oct 28, 2024
Perfect, thank you so much, exactly what I asked for and incredibly responsive. Will definitely work with Sherif again
TG
Thamira G.
Dec 22, 2025
Adobe Premiere Pro Expert Needed for Automated Image-to-Timeline Alignment
Good experience. Work done as described.
DS
Donald S.
Feb 13, 2025
Photoshop script per messages
Sherif was very professional and efficient. He asked the correct questions, made the correct suggestions, and completed the work per better than requested.
TG
Timothy G.
Jan 12, 2025
InDesign scripting
BW
Billy W.
Dec 16, 2024
Adobe InDesign - Script to Build DataMerge Document
JH
Josh H.
Dec 2, 2024
I need help converting a PDF to an InDesign file
About Sherif
Backend Engineer | NestJS, TypeScript, AI Integration
100%
Job Success
Banha, Egypt - 1:18 am local time
🚀 What I've Shipped:
- Multi-app monorepo backends coordinating API + Discord/Twitch services + Next.js + Electron desktop apps, with clean architecture and a layered JWT/2FA/HMAC auth stack
- Multi-tenant SaaS systems with per-tenant schema isolation and atomic cross-tenant migrations
- AI pipelines using OpenAI, Gemini, and Whisper with response caching, retry/timeout patterns, and per-tenant cost tracking
- A commercial UXP plugin shipped end-to-end with a Cloudflare Workers licensing API
✨ Technical Stack:
- Frameworks: NestJS, Node.js, TypeScript
- Databases: PostgreSQL, Prisma, TypeORM, Redis, MongoDB
- Infra: Docker, BullMQ, WebSockets, Pusher, Pino, Sentry
- AI: OpenAI, Google Gemini, Whisper
📊 Industries: SaaS, HR Tech, Streaming/Community, Creator Tools.
How we start: share scope → I send a free technical plan → small first milestone.
Steps for completing your project
After purchasing the project, send requirements so Sherif can start the project.
Delivery time starts when Sherif receives requirements from you.
Sherif works on your project following the steps below.
Revisions may occur after the delivery date.
Start the script
The developer begins work on creating the custom script, testing and making revisions as necessary, and will keep the client updated on the progress of the script development.

